05/28/2010 - Milwaukee, WI (Sportsbook Betting Lines) - The Milwaukee Brewers have placed outfielder Jody Gerut on the 15-day disabled list with a bruised left heel.

The move is retroactive to May 23.

Gerut, over 32 games in mostly a reserve role, is batting just .197 with two homers and eight runs batted in.

The Brewers recalled outfielder Adam Stern from Triple-A Nashville to fill the vacant roster spot. Stern will join the parent club for a third time this season and has seen action in four games, notching a run batted in.

Huskers' Lucky hospitalized for undisclosed reason

LINCOLN, Neb. -- Nebraska running back Marlon Lucky was hospitalized Monday for undisclosed reasons after Lincoln police responded to a call at his residence.

The Nebraska athletic department said in a release Monday that Lucky was admitted Sunday night.

A nursing supervisor at the hospital said all questions about Lucky were being referred to the athletic department. The athletic department said there would be no further comment from the department or Lucky's family.

A Lincoln Police spokesman said officers responded to a call at Lucky's residence 11:30 p.m. Sunday. The spokesman said he didn't know Lucky's condition at the time he was taken to the hospital.

Lucky, from North Hollywood, Calif., started six games last season as a sophomore and was the team's second-leading rusher, with 728 yards and six touchdowns. He also caught 32 passes for 383 yards. He averaged 19.1 yards on eight kickoff returns.
